Jak skonfigurować dostęp SSH do komputera z uruchomionym Arch Linux Iso (Livecd)?

Jak ustawić / skonfigurować bootcd Arch Linux (live-CD, ISO), abym mógł się do niego zalogować za pomocą klienta SSH?

A jakie hasło jest domyślnie ustawione dla konta root (automatycznego logowania)?

Odpowiedź

Domyślne hasło roota dla dystrybucja ISO jest pusta. Domyślnie nie możesz zalogować się przez SSH przy użyciu pustego hasła.

Dlatego potrzebne są dwie komendy:

  1. passwd – Aby ustawić niepuste hasło dla aktualnie zalogowanego użytkownika (” root „dla liveCD). Wprowadź hasło dwukrotnie.

  2. systemctl start sshd.service – Aby rozpocząć ssh.

Teraz możesz zalogować się ze swojego komputera klienckiego za pomocą ssh root@ip-address.


PS Nie znasz adresu IP? Live-CD zawiera polecenia ifconfig i ip address.

Komentarze

  • Upewnij się, że po uruchomieniu passwd

wpisujesz hasło dwukrotnie

Odpowiedź

Najprostszym sposobem jest

  • zainstaluj Arch na pendrive / dysku twardym (możesz to zrobić z Live CD)
  • w nowej instalacji
    • ustaw hasło roota (passwd)
    • zezwól na logowanie do katalogu głównego ssh (vi /etc/ssh/sshd_config i dołącz PermitRootLogin yes)
    • włącz sshd (systemctl enable sshd)
    • nie zapomnij także włączyć systemd-networkd czegokolwiek innego, co możesz trzeba (np. wstępnie skonfigurować wifi)
  • uruchomić nową maszynę z urządzenia USB

Komentarze

  • Pytanie dotyczy tylko rozwiązania rozruchowego z Live-CD (ISO). instalacja na pendrive / dysku twardym jest poza zakresem tego pytania.
  • @ProBackup ta odpowiedź jest dla osób, które próbują zainstalować arch w systemie bez wyświetlacza / klawiatury.

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*